Haiti Election Day - Not even the president of Haiti can vote!

Mezanmi LOBEY... Rene Preval, The President of Haiti cannot vote because his voting center, Lycee Marie-Jeanne, is closed "jusqu'a nouvel ordre"

Why not?

NO INK AVAILABLE!

Radio Kyskeya reports...

"According to the general supervisor of the polling center at Lycee Marie-Jeanne, William Jeanty, the center is closed until further notice due to a lack of INK.

It should be noted that the Lycee Marie-Jeanne is the designated polling station of President Rene Preval."
